Output ff518def30f96497b502255323ae521301c154453d08c7064a8c0d0764458954:15

value
800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 100920eba8e6f91c2cf72b8674ae672fe852d5cf OP_EQUALVERIFY OP_CHECKSIG
address
12TnkLSmvYwBu8srKGWo5RVUHqKAVBU3Qi
transaction
ff518def30f96497b502255323ae521301c154453d08c7064a8c0d0764458954
confirmations
397221
spent
true